Marlborough Way is in Sticker, St. Austell and in Restormel district. PL26 7EX is located in the St Mewan & Grampound elect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of St Austell and Newquay.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ding PL26 7EX,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 52%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ate vicinity of PL26 7EX there is a very large concentration of residents that are married - 62.1% of the resident population. In contrast, the average marriage rate across the census is about 44%.

Areas with a high percentage of married residents are typically suburban neighborhoods, towns with good schools and family-friendly amenities, and regions with affordable, spacious housing options. Additionally, such areas can be popular among retirees.

Safety

Is Marlborough Way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Marlborough Way was 44.4 per 1,000 residents, which is 38.9% higher than the St Goran, Tregony & the Roseland average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Marlborough Way has the 22nd highest crime rate of 59 local areas in St Goran, Tregony & the Roseland and the 841st lowest crime rate of 1,819 local areas in Cornwall .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 18.5 crimes per 1,000 residents and have remained broadly unchanged year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-61.9%.
